What This Guide Helps With
Printer not feeding paper, paper jams, blank prints, or poor print quality due to paper loading, incorrect media, or mechanical obstruction.
Step-by-Step Troubleshooting
Ensure Patient Safety First
- If the device is in use, stop ECG acquisition and move the patient to another EKG machine if printing is required.
- Expected: Patient care continues without interruption.
- Why it matters: Printing issues should not delay diagnosis or documentation.
Verify the Reported Issue
- Attempt to print a test ECG or stored report.
- Observe: No paper feed, paper stops mid-print, blank or faded output, error messages on display.
- Expected: Issue is reproducible and clearly identified.
- Why it matters: Confirms whether this is a feed issue, jam, or print quality problem.
Check Paper Supply and Type
- Open the printer compartment and inspect the paper roll.
- Ensure paper is present and not empty.
- Confirm correct thermal paper type for Schiller AT Series.
- Check that paper width matches device requirements.
- Expected: Proper paper is installed.
- Why it matters: Incorrect or missing paper is a common cause of feed and print issues.
Verify Paper Orientation
- Confirm the thermal paper is loaded correctly.
- Ensure paper feeds from the correct direction (thermal side aligned with print head).
- Reload paper if unsure.
- Expected: Paper feeds smoothly when printing.
- Why it matters: Incorrect orientation results in blank prints or no output.
Inspect for Paper Jam or Obstruction
- Check inside the printer compartment.
- Remove any jammed or torn paper.
- Ensure no debris is blocking the feed path.
- Gently clear obstructions without forcing components.
- Expected: Paper path is clear and unobstructed.
- Why it matters: Even small obstructions can prevent proper feeding.
Check Printer Cover and Latch
- Ensure the printer door is fully closed and latched.
- Open and firmly close the printer cover.
- Listen/feel for proper latch engagement.
- Expected: Printer recognizes the cover as closed and allows printing.
- Why it matters: Many units will not print if the cover is not properly secured.
Perform a Test Feed or Calibration
- Use the device’s feed or test print function.
- Press paper feed button (if available).
- Run internal test print if accessible.
- Expected: Paper advances smoothly and prints clearly.
- Why it matters: Helps isolate feed mechanism vs system issue.
Inspect Print Quality (If Feeding Occurs)
- If paper feeds but print is poor:
- Look for faded, uneven, or missing print.
- Clean print head using approved method (lint-free cloth if accessible).
- Replace paper roll with a new one.
- Expected: Clear, legible ECG printout.
- Why it matters: Dirty print heads or degraded paper affect output quality.
Power Cycle the Device
- Restart the EKG machine.
- Turn off the unit.
- Wait 10–15 seconds.
- Power back on and retry printing.
- Expected: Printer resets and functions normally.
- Why it matters: Clears minor system or printer communication faults.
If the Problem Persists
If all external causes have been ruled out, the issue is likely internal (printer mechanism, motor, or control circuitry).
Remove the device from service, label it Out of Service, and send for repair or bench evaluation.
Knowing when to stop prevents unnecessary damage and ensures proper repair handling.

Work Order Documentation (CCR Method)
CCR = Complaint, Cause, Resolution
Complaint
What was reported by the clinical staff.
Example:
"EKG machine not printing; paper not feeding during ECG acquisition."
Cause
What was observed during troubleshooting.
Example:
"Paper roll installed incorrectly, preventing proper feed."
Resolution
What action was taken.
Example:
"Reinstalled paper correctly and verified proper feed and print function."
Helpful Details to Include (If Known)
- Alarm behavior or error messages observed
- Accessories swapped (paper roll, cleaning performed)
- Power behavior during printing attempts
- Environmental factors (humidity, debris, heavy use)
- Indicator lights or printer status messages
- Test print or feed results
- Final device status
